► Steel Mesh Moving Seedbed
• Steel mesh moving seedbed is widely used for potted flower, vegetable seedling, rice seedling and traditional Chinese herbal medicine seedling cultivation. Not only saving land but also increasing production.
• Structure: The moving seedbed is composed of mesh, aluminum alloy frame, lateral braces, rollers, handwheels, legs, diagonal rods etc.

► Accessories of Steel Mesh Moving Seedbed
Aluminum alloy frame 65

The aluminum alloy frame of the seedbed

(65) 4 corners of seedbed frame, made of engineeringplastic

(65) Conjunction of the seedbed frame, made of engineering plastic.

Lateral Braces
The lateral braces are to support the steel wire mesh on the bed surface and connect the aluminum alloy frame. The material is galvanized square tube, with a specification of 20*30*1.5, can also be folded into ∩-shaped. The spacing between the lateral braces is 0.5m. For cost reduction purposes, the spacing can also be expanded to 0.66 meters.
Increasing the spacing between lateral braces reduces the bearing capacity of the bed surface. For potted flowers, the spacing should not be less than 0.5m, and for tray seedling cultivation, it is flexible.

Steel Mesh
The steel mesh is galvanized after welding, with a diameter of 3.0mm and a mesh size of 130mm*30mm, customized according to the width and length of the seedbed. The steel mesh is fixed on the aluminum alloy frame and the lateral braces underneath.

Mesh Tablet Press
Galvanized sheet stamping is used to fix the mesh, which is fixed on the aluminum alloy frame and the lateral braces underneath.

Mesh Connection Joints
Galvanized sheet stamping is to connect the mesh, with the mesh connection joints placed on the lateral braces underneath.

Anti-overturning Card
The anti overturning card is made of plastic, to connect the seedbed surface and support legs, and also to prevent the surface from overturning when it rotates to one side.

Roller Tube, Shrink Mouth Tube
Galvanized steel with a diameter of 48×1.8. Each seedbed is equipped with 2 roller tubes for left and right side movement of the bed surface. Each roller tube is equipped with a handwheel at one end and a pipe plug at the other. Shrink mouth tube is for connecting roller tubes.

Support Legs, Adjusting Pedestals
The support legs are made of steel pipes welded and galvanized, with a specification of 20*40*1.5, a height of 600mm, and a width of 1080mm, to support the bed surface with a 2m space. The adjusting pedestal is welded and galvanized to adjust the level of the bed surface.

Plastic Pedestal, “7”nail
When cement hardening cannot be carried out in the project, plastic pedestals are used to support the seedbed. The “7”nails are to fix plastic pedestals.

Rivet: to fix the corners of the seedbed
Drill tail wire: to fix aluminum alloy frames, lateral braces, anti flip clips, handwheels, and shrink month tubes
Galvanized hexagonal bolt: to fix slant support
Expansion bolt: to fix the support legs onto the ground or the plastic pedestals

► Characteristics of Steel Mesh Moving Seedbed
• Manual driven, easy to operate, convenient to move.
• The frame of the seedbed is made of aluminum alloy, which can move left and right. A 0.6m channel is between any two seedbeds, increasing the usage area of the greenhouse to about 80%.
• The main frame and mesh are both galvanized, which can be used for a long period in humid environments.
• The operation process for planting is easy and equipped with a limit anti overturning device to prevent tilting problems caused by excessive weight.
